Philip J. Clucas
Epithet: First World War sailor
Record type: First World War Biographies
Town / Village residence: Douglas
Biography: First World War Sailor. 'No. B.4704. Able Seaman. R.N.R. (Royal Naval Reserve). Reported Oct. Dec. Mar. 9. Brother of Wm. H. Clucas R.N.R. Address 15 Mess. H.M.S. Eclipse G.P.O. (General Post Office). London May 31. on H.M.S. Australia Dec. 14. Mess 16 G.P.O. London Nov. 1916 as before Apr as before Nov. 1917 H.B.R.W.R. 1 Mess. H.M.S. Asphodel. G.P.O. London Nov. 1918 as before.' (Extract from handwritten notes by The Reverend Robert Daniel Kermode, Vicar of St George's Church, Douglas, about men from his parish serving in the First World War. MS 10003/3)
